"many thanks" vs "many many thanks"

Both 'many thanks' and 'many many thanks' are correct phrases used to express gratitude. 'Many thanks' is a common and concise way to say thank you, while 'many many thanks' adds emphasis to show extra appreciation. The choice between the two depends on the level of gratitude you want to convey.

many thanks

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English to express gratitude.

This phrase is a polite and concise way to say thank you. It is commonly used in both formal and informal situations.

Examples:

  • Many thanks for your help.
  • I wanted to extend my many thanks for your support.

Alternatives:

  • thank you
  • thanks a lot
  • thanks so much
  • thanks a million
  • thanks

many many thanks

This phrase is correct and used to express even more gratitude than 'many thanks'.

'Many many thanks' is an emphatic way to show extra appreciation. It is used when you want to express a higher level of gratitude.

Examples:

  • Many many thanks for going above and beyond.
  • I owe you many many thanks for your kindness.

Alternatives:

  • thank you so much
  • thanks a million
  • thanks a bunch
  • thanks a ton
  • thanks heaps
